Parámetros del producto

4-Iodoisoquinoline CAS:55270-33-2 is a white to off-white crystalline solid with a melting point of 135-137°C. It is soluble in organic solvents such as chloroform, acetone, and ethanol, but sparingly soluble in water. The molecular formula of 4-Iodoisoquinoline is C9H6IN, and its molecular weight is 254.98 g/mol. The following table provides a detailed overview of the product's physical and chemical properties:
